A small town has a problem with fights breaking out between groups of teenagers who live in different parts of the county. One group, who live on Blackstone Road, wear black Adidas hats to identify themselves. The other, who live on Greenbriar Trail, wear green John Deere hats. Because fights have become common at the high school, the school board passed a rule banning headwear of any kind on school grounds. Later that school year, a new student moved in from Jamaica and is a practicing Rasafarian. As a Rastafarian, he is not required to cover his head, but within his faith covering ones head is a sign of devotion to God and the student is very devoted to his faith. When he is banned from wearing his head covering to school, his parents sue the school for violating his First Amendment rights.
Question: The Sherbert Test is a balancing test, meaning the prongs of the test are considered individually, but the courts decision comes from which way the issue is leaning after all the prongs are considered together. Which is the most important prong for the student to win?
